Western Star to Celebrate its 40th Anniversary
REDFORD, MI –Western Star Trucks is celebrating its 40th anniversary in 2007, and will mark the occasion at the Great American Trucking Show in Dallas, August 23-25.

The Western Star booth (#18128) will be decked out with anniversary décor, and attendees will have the chance to enjoy giveaways, a unique sand sculpture of a Western Star truck, and more.
Western Star began with engineering and operations located in Cleveland and production in Canada. In the following years, the company was headquartered in Kelowna, British Columbia. After it was acquired by Freightliner LLC in 2001, the headquarters relocated first to Cleveland and later to Redford.
One of the centerpieces of the Western Star booth will be a large sand sculpture shaped like a Western Star truck that features Western Star’s 40th Anniversary logo on the side. While checking out the sand truck, visitors can also pick up a free limited edition 40th Anniversary Western Star hat (while supplies last) and enter a giveaway for the chance to win a Visa gift card.
Attendees can check out the following Western Star trucks: 4900 EX with 82-inch Ultra High Stratosphere sleeper and Detroit Diesel Series 60 engine with custom True Fire airbrushing from Killer Paint and the 4900 SA oil field service bed truck with butterfly hood and Detroit Diesel Series 60 engine.
